Get chatting on the Cruises.co.uk forum

Whether you want to talk about your most recent cruise, find out what other travellers think of a certain itinerary, or simply get something off your chest, the forum at Cruises.co.uk can help.

Our forum is completely free to use and is a great way to communicate with fellow cruisers, as well as being a good source of advice – you can even make suggestions if you think you might be able to help deal with another user's query!

Forum topics

Our forum is dedicated to all things cruise related, so no matter what you want to know about a holiday sailing the seas, you are sure to find it here.

You will be able to view posts about different cruise lines we work with, such as P&O, Cunard, MSC and Fred. Olsen, allowing you to ask others what they thought of the ships and itineraries offered by these providers.

Reading cruise reviews is a great way to help you narrow down your options if you are looking for a holiday, giving you honest and impartial advice about the various trips on the market.

You will also be able to read up on the latest cruise news and find out more about which stops other travellers particularly enjoyed visiting.

What's more, there are dedicated threads for solo cruising, breaks for families and joining a trip if you or one of your party is disabled, so you can pick up useful tips about the most appropriate itineraries for you and handy hints on how to make your break truly memorable.

You might discover that our forum is a great place to seek out the best cruise deals, as all the latest discounts will be posted on here to help you book a holiday for less than you may think!

There really is something for everyone on our forum, with plenty of discussions about more specialised cruises, such as those going on expeditions or trips themed around a particular activity.

Get to know people on Cruises.co.uk

Another advantage to our forum – particularly if you are travelling alone – is that you can start chatting to fellow cruisers booked on the same voyage as you well before you board the ship.

That means as soon as you step aboard you will have some friends to spend time with and can look forward to getting to know people better as you journey to some truly wonderful destinations.

Just look for the All Aboard section on our forum and you can add yourself to the cruise roll call, tell others a bit about your interests and see who you meet along the way!

And if you want to learn some more about any of the specialists who help you find the perfect breaks, just have a look at the Cruise Consultants sub-forum, where you'll find a short biography about all of our members of staff.
